The Food in St. George, UT

The culinary scene in St. George is diverse, offering a range of options from fast food to fine dining. However, it may not fully satisfy those accustomed to the variety found in larger cities.

Fast Food and Restaurant Chains

St. George has a wide selection of fast food and restaurant chains. These options are convenient and cater to a variety of tastes.

  • Fast food chains

  • Restaurant chains

Limited High-End Dining

One of the common complaints among new residents is the lack of high-end dining options. People coming from cities like Chicago, New York, or Los Angeles may find the local offerings limited.

While there are some fine dining establishments, the variety is not as extensive as in larger metropolitan areas. This has led some residents to travel to nearby cities like Las Vegas for a more upscale dining experience.

Growing Demand for More Options

There is a growing demand for more diverse and high-quality dining options in St. George. As the city continues to grow, it's likely that the culinary scene will expand to meet these needs.

In summary, while St. George may not yet have the extensive culinary variety found in larger cities, it offers a solid range of dining options that are continually improving.

The Crime Rate in St. George, UT

One of the appealing aspects of living in St. George is its relatively low crime rate. This contributes to the overall sense of safety and community well-being.

Comparing Crime Rates

St. George's crime statistics are favorable when compared to national averages. For instance, the violent crime rate in St. George is 11.2, significantly lower than the U.S. average of 22.7.

Property Crime

Property crime in St. George is also below the national average. The city's rate stands at 29.9, compared to the U.S. average of 35.4. Most incidents involve theft, so residents are advised to lock their cars and homes.

Community Cleanliness

Residents and visitors often comment on the cleanliness of St. George. The city lacks graffiti and litter, thanks to the efforts of city workers and the pride residents take in their community.

The Airport in St. George, UT

The St. George Regional Airport provides convenient but pricey air travel options. It's a smaller airport, which offers several advantages and a few drawbacks.

Convenience and Speed

One of the main benefits of the St. George airport is its small size. Security checks are quick, and you don't need to arrive hours before your flight.

  • Quick security checks

  • Less crowded

High Costs

However, flights out of St. George can be expensive. Many residents opt to travel to Las Vegas, just two hours away, to take advantage of cheaper flights.

Future Prospects

There is hope that as St. George grows, more airlines will operate out of the local airport, driving down costs. The airport is already home to SkyWest Airlines, which provides numerous jobs.

The Retirement Communities in St. George, UT

St. George is a popular retirement destination, offering a variety of 55+ communities with numerous amenities tailored for senior residents.

Appeal for Retirees

Many retirees are drawn to St. George to escape harsh winters and enjoy the pleasant weather. The city has several communities designed to cater specifically to this demographic.

Amenities and Activities

These retirement communities offer a range of amenities, including pickleball courts, pools, and fitness classes. Sun River is a notable example, providing clubs and performances for an active lifestyle.

Impact on Real Estate

The influx of retirees has contributed to higher real estate prices in St. George. Retirees often purchase homes with cash, having built up equity over their lifetimes, which can be a double-edged sword for the housing market.

The Water in St. George, UT

Water conservation is a crucial aspect of life in St. George, given its desert environment. The city has implemented several measures to address this issue.

Water Conservancy District

The local Water Conservancy District has developed a comprehensive 20-year plan to manage water resources effectively. This plan is essential for accommodating the area's growth.

  • Long-term water strategy

  • Supports city growth

Landscaping Changes

Residents are encouraged to adopt desert landscaping to conserve water. This includes replacing grass with more water-efficient plants and trees suitable for the region.

  • Desert landscaping

  • Water-efficient plants

Infrastructure Improvements

New subdivisions are being equipped with water reuse lines, and additional reservoirs are being constructed. These efforts aim to ensure a sustainable water supply for the future.
